Abstract

The present invention comprises a catalyst system, catalyst complex, and a process for the polymerization and copolymerization of alpha-olefins in which the process is carried out in the presence of a catalyst system comprising an organic compound of a metal of Group Ib, IIa, IIIb, or IVb of the Periodic Table and a solid catalyst complex prepared by reacting a divalent metal halide, an organic oxygen compound of a metal of Group IVa, Va, or VIa of the Periodic Table, and an aluminum halide.
